nfs-ganesha-mem binary package in Ubuntu Bionic s390x
NFS-GANESHA is a NFS Server running in user space with a large cache.
It comes with various backend modules to support different file systems
and namespaces. Supported name spaces are POSIX, PROXY, SNMP, FUSE-like,
HPSS, LUSTRE, XFS and ZFS.
This package contains a library for a FSAL_MEM and an example mem.conf file
